The Future of Autosamplers: Trends, Innovations, and Opportunities to 2033

Author : Babita Iyar | Published On : 20 Aug 2026

 

The global laboratory automation landscape is on the verge of a profound transformation, driven by relentless innovation and the imperative for higher analytical precision. As laboratories worldwide strive for greater throughput and zero-error workflows, the demand for advanced Autosamplers has never been more critical. Currently valued at $796.3 million, the market is projected to expand significantly, exhibiting a robust CAGR of 6.2% over the forecast period.

Emerging Trends and Technological Disruptions



 The next decade will witness a paradigm shift in how sample introduction systems operate. The integ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ning is enabling predictive maintenance and real-time error detection, virtually eliminating costly downtime. Furthermore, digitalization and Internet of Things (IoT) connectivity are turning traditional instruments into smart, cloud-integrated nodes capable of remote monitoring. Sustainability is another major catalyst; manufacturers are prioritizing energy-efficient designs and solvent-reducing technologies to align with global green laboratory initiatives, propelling the market forward at a steady 6.2% CAGR.

 

High-Growth Segments of Tomorrow



 Growth will be unevenly distributed, with certain segments capturing the lion's share of future opportunities. Across product types, both LC Autosamplers and GC Autosamplers are evolving to handle ultra-low sample volumes with unprecedented precision. From an application standpoint, the Pharmaceutical & Biopharmaceutical Industry remains the primary growth engine, fueled by biologics and personalized medicine R&D. Meanwhile, the Environmental Testing Industry and Food & Beverage Industry are exhibiting surging demand for high-throughput screening to meet stringent regulatory compliance and safety standards, alongside steady contributions from the Oil & Gas Industry.

 

Pioneers and Innovators



 The competitive arena is defined by aggressive R&D investments and strategic collaborations aimed at next-generation product development. Industry pioneers such as Agilent, Waters, Shimadzu, Thermo Fisher, PerkinElmer, Merck, Bio-Rad, Restek, Gilson, JASCO, and SCION are leading the charge. These market leaders are focusing on modular architectures, cross-platform compatibility, and intuitive software interfaces to secure a competitive edge and shape the future standard of laboratory automation.

 

Future Regional Dynamics



 Regional adoption of next-generation automation will vary based on industrial maturity and regulatory frameworks. North America (United States, Canada, Mexico) continues to be an early adopter of smart laboratory technologies, backed by robust healthcare and pharmaceutical spending. Europe (United Kingdom, Germany, France, Italy, Spain, Russia, Benelux, Nordics, Rest of Europe) is heavily driven by stringent environmental and safety regulations, pushing labs toward sustainable automation. Meanwhile, Asia Pacific (China, India, Japan, South Korea, ASEAN, Oceania, Rest of Asia Pacific) represents the fastest-growing frontier, propelled by expanding life science research infrastructure and booming pharmaceutical manufacturing. South America (Brazil, Argentina, Rest of South America) and the Middle East & Africa (Turkey, Israel, GCC, North Africa, South Africa, Rest of Middle East & Africa) present emerging pockets of opportunity as local healthcare and analytical testing standards modernize.
